Rule 261-39.7 - Selection criteria

The following factors shall be considered in the selection of a city for participation in the program:

(1) The applicant has a well-planned budget demonstrating sustainable funding for ongoing operations and evidence of adequate local sources of funding to support the traditional commercial district revitalization organization and its programming.
(2) The applicant has garnered broad-based financial and philosophical community support for the local program including support from the city.
(3) The applicant has provided evidence of willingness by local stakeholders to get involved in the effort.
(4) The applicant has demonstrated its commitment to the main street approach and has hired or will be hiring an executive director to manage the local program.
(5) The applicant is committed to historic preservation and preservation-based economic development and has demonstrated its commitment by a track record of preservation planning and a commitment to future preservation projects.
(6) The applicant has provided evidence of traditional commercial district planning efforts and clearly defined goals for the future.
(7) The applicant has defined an organizational structure to manage local program efforts.
(8) The applicant demonstrates an eagerness to learn and implement traditional commercial district revitalization strategies and techniques.
(9) The applicant has clearly defined the boundaries of the proposed traditional commercial district and has articulated the reasons behind the location of the boundaries.
(10) The applicant has identified a traditional commercial district that has clear potential for success, as demonstrated by the presence of the following elements:
a. Existence of historic character of the traditional commercial district.
b. Plans for the traditional commercial district demonstrate a recognition of traditional commercial district trends and address the challenges unique to that district.
c. Present market capacity defined by a current business environment upon which the district can build its revitalization efforts.
d. Present physical capacity defined by building stock and built environment upon which the district can build its revitalization efforts.
